Flask是一个轻量级的Python Web框架,它简单易用且灵活,适合快速开发Web应用程序。Apache是一个流行的开源Web服务器软件,而mod_wsgi是Apache的一个模块,用于将Python应用程序与Apache进行集成。 初始化使用Apache和mod_wsgi运行的Flask应用程序的步骤如下: 安装Apache和mod_wsgi:在服务器上安装Apache和mod_wsgi模块,...
下面是一个flask应用的基本配置,没考虑安全因素,只是测试发布: 代码语言:javascript 代码运行次数:0 复制Cloud Studio 代码运行 <VirtualHost *:8000> WSGIScriptAlias /flask D:\002-Code\pycode\wsgi.py <Directory D:\002-Code\pycode> Require all granted </Directory> </VirtualHost> 未经允许不得转载:肥猫博...
部署Flask应用后,如果访问时出现HTTP 500错误,可能是由于配置问题或代码错误。请检查Apache配置文件中的WSGIDaemonProcess和WSGIProcessGroup指令是否正确设置。同时,检查Flask应用的代码是否存在错误。解决方案:检查Apache配置文件中的WSGIDaemonProcess和WSGIProcessGroup指令设置;检查Flask应用代码是否存在错误,并修复错误。问题4...
参考: Flask教程 mod_wsgi文档 https://stackoverflow.com/questions/44914961/install-mod-wsgi-on-ubuntu-with-python-3-6-apache-2-4-and-django-1-11 Project/Python部分 准备WSGI文件 准备一个wsgi.py文件,内容如下: importsys sys.path.insert(0,"<path_to_the_application>")fromyourapplicationimportapp...
flask在windows上用mod_wsgi部署也是折腾了不少时间,下面就总结下。 首先下载Apache httpd,我认为Apache Hans比较好; 一般这种情况下,你的python环境已经安装好了,只是你要确认自己pc上的python的版本,然后就是下载windows下的预编译好的mod_wsgi; 在下载mod_wsgi时一定要认真,确认你的python版本和平台、还有你下载的...
1:首先写一个最简单的Flask 应用,并进行发布:这里在跟 apache24 同一目录下也就是 C盘根目录下:创建mydir目录。在目录中写两个文件:hello.py 和myapp.wsgi: image hello.py: fromflaskimportFlask app=Flask(__name__)@app.route("/")defhello():return"Hello World!终于成功了。我擦"if__name__=='...
1、Apache安装: https://httpd.apache.org/download.cgi 选择你电脑适合的版本,我的电脑是64位: 在要放置apache服务器的位置...
The only argument to mod_wsgi-express specifies a script containing your Flask application, which must be called application. You can write a small script to import your app with this name, or to create it if using the app factory pattern. wsgi.py from hello import app application = app ...
如果服务器是用的 Apache,那么 Flask 官方推荐用mod_wsgi,文档可以戳这,其实 Flask 官方文档已经写的很清楚了,我还是贴一下吧。 Ubuntu or Debian: # apt-get install libapache2-mod-wsgi Copy 修改Apache 配置: 然后修改/etc/apache2/sites-enabled/000-default: ...
浅淡flask在win下用Apache24及mod_wsgi部署的那些坑 安装部署就不指描述了,毕竟网上多得很,就说说一些坑吧。 1、中文路径问题,正常情况,Apache里配置文件用中文路径是会出错的,我们可以把配置文件先备份,然…